**Alert: Cron drift detected (Tickhouse scheduler)**

Scheduled jobs on the Tickhouse fleet are firing 3–8 minutes late. Ongoing investigation; suspected NTP skew on the batch nodes. Do not restart the scheduler — it resets drift metrics we're collecting. Affected jobs retry automatically; no data loss expected. Log any anomalies you see in the incident doc. Questions or new drift sightings go to the scheduling team at the address below.

pager mailbox: silael.sorwyn.tamius@zemvarsys.corp

## Changelog — Glyphbarrel 3.2

The setting FONT_MIRROR_KEY has been renamed for clarity, since vendored third-party fonts are now fetched through the Quillhaven mirror. Plugin authors should update their plugin.env accordingly: keep the mirror URL line as-is, remove the old key entry, and write the new mirror credential on the line directly below the URL.

vault entry, yahif-yajep: COURIER_KEY29=b802bdf8034096b65a51c6ba5abe2

Before promoting a new build of the Skywarden fan-out service, verify that the staging replay of last week's alert traffic completed with zero dropped regions and that per-channel delivery latency stayed under the two-second budget. Pay particular attention to the county-code mapping table: a stale mapping is the most common cause of silent delivery gaps, and it will not surface in unit tests. Sign-off requires both the replay report and a manual spot check of three rural regions. The promotion checklist is kept on the internal page here:

operations page: https://jenkins.zemvarcloud.local/job/merge_requests/repo/build/73930b4b30f0a8ed